Records team — handing over the locked case of Talverin test handsets from the Greymoor pilot. Eight devices, inventory sheet taped inside the lid. Case stays sealed until the audit sign-off. Norcliffe Express collects it Thursday afternoon from reception. Their courier will surrender the case only after hearing the phrase set out below.

handover note for yagef-bagep: the drudor pelius courier leaves the kasdor zorvan norir ledger at gate 8016 under passcode 755406

**Q: How do I get into the shared lab with the Tresco team at night?**

The lab on Level 5 is shared with the Tresco analytics group. Night-shift staff may enter after 20:00 but must log in at the bench terminal and leave equipment as found. No visitors. Badge taps alone won't work after hours; also enter the code below.

badge for hawip-taweg: bdg-QFZSW-38965

Hello plugin authors,

Next Thursday, Corbexa will run a disaster-recovery drill for the RestockRoute vending-machine restock planner. During the failover window, plugin callbacks will be replayed against the standby scheduler, so please ensure your handlers are idempotent and tolerate duplicate route assignments. No customer restock data will be altered. To re-register your plugin against the standby environment during the drill, authenticate with the recovery passphrase provided below.

vault phrase of hahip-tajeg = quenax-briath-briax